Correct installation is crucial to optimizing the efficiency and lifespan of wood windows. Here’s an in-depth breakdown of the installation process:
Step 1: PreparationCollect Tools: Prepare a toolkit that includes a level, measuring tape, square, utility knife, hammer, nails, and shims.Check the Opening: Before installation, ensure that the window opening is tidy, dry, and without any obstructions.Action 2: Remove Old WindowsThoroughly remove any existing windows, making sure not to damage the surrounding framework.Examine the condition of the window frame. If it’s rotten or compromised, repairs might be necessary before continuing.Step 3: Install the New WindowDry Fit: Place the new window into the opening without fastening to look for fit.Check Level: Ensure the window is level and plumb. Usage shims to change as necessary.Protect Window: Fasten the window to the frame following the maker’s instructions, generally utilizing screws.Seal: Apply insulation foam around the window edges, guaranteeing a tight seal to avoid drafts.Step 4: Finish UpInclude trim around the window to improve visual appeals and seal spaces.Caulk outside edges for a weather-tight surface.Tidy any particles or dust from both the exterior and interior.Typical Mistakes in Wood Window Installation

Ignoring Energy Efficiency Ratings: Not looking for energy rankings may cause increased cooling and heating costs.Improper Measurements: Always double-check measurements before acquiring new windows.Overlooking Flashing: Failing to install appropriate flashing can result in water leakages, compromising the stability of both the window and wall.Forgetting to Paint or Stain: Skipping paint or stain can lead to wood decay over time. Constantly deal with the wood before installation.Poor Sealing Practices: Not sealing gaps can result in drafts and wetness invasion.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How can I preserve my wood windows?
A1: Regular maintenance consists of cleansing windows with a mild soap option, checking for any signs of rot or damage, and using finishes to protect the wood from UV damage and wetness.
Q2: Can I install wood windows myself?
A2: While convenient homeowners may try DIY setups, it’s suggested to work with professional installers to make sure the windows are installed correctly and efficiently.
Q3: How do I choose the right wood for my windows?
A3: Consider the looks, climate conditions, and maintenance requirements. Seek advice from producers or experts for recommendations based upon your particular requirements.
Q4: How frequently should I replace my wood windows?
A4: With appropriate maintenance, top quality wood windows can last 20 to 50 years. Regular assessments can assist you determine when replacement is needed.
Q5: What are the expenses connected with wood window installation?
A5: Costs may differ based upon the kind of wood, design of the window, and labor costs in your location. Typically, property owners can anticipate to invest between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,200 per window, consisting of installation.
